The Vision
In July 2003, the Oldham Partnership (Oldham’s Local Strategic Partnership) and the Northwest Regional Development Agency appointed an international team of regeneration specialists, led by Urbed, to identify the Oldham Beyond vision.
The team undertook in-depth analysis and extensive consultation, which included talking to more than 2,000 residents in the ‘Thought Bubble’ (an inflatable room that toured the Borough). They then set out the vision in a series of reports that were produced in April 2004:

Some of the regeneration proposals within the vision are:
Development of Hollinwood at Junction 22 of the M60 into a sub-regional, business location
Expansion of the further- and higher-education institutions in Oldham Town Centre
Creation of a range of quality homes as part of Housing Market Renewal
Improvement of the local town centres as focal points for local communities
Extension of Greater Manchester’s Metrolink network to Oldham
The vision was awarded for its ‘originality and innovation in regeneration’ by the Northwest Centre for Regeneration Excellence in its Exemplar Programme for 2004-2005.
